Essential Tradecraft Techniques for Surveillance

Surveillance, a critical component of intelligence operations, involves a series of tailored tradecraft techniques designed to gather information discreetly and effectively. Techniques such as physical surveillance, technical surveillance, and electronic monitoring are key methods employed to observe targets without detection, ensuring the integrity of the operation.

Physical surveillance involves agents observing subjects in real-time, employing tactics such as following movements on foot or using vehicles to track the target. Maintaining a low profile through natural movements and inconspicuous attire enhances the success of these operations, making agents less noticeable.

Technical surveillance utilizes devices like cameras, listening devices, and GPS trackers to gather critical insights. These tools allow for comprehensive monitoring without requiring the presence of an observer, providing valuable data while minimizing risk to personnel.

Electronic monitoring, encompassing cyber surveillance, focuses on gathering intelligence from digital communications. This includes intercepting emails and monitoring social media platforms, leveraging technological advancements to enhance the efficacy of surveillance in contemporary intelligence operations. The integration of these tradecraft techniques ensures comprehensive situational awareness and informed decision-making.

Communication Tradecraft Techniques

Communication tradecraft techniques refer to the methodologies employed by intelligence operatives to exchange information securely and efficiently. These techniques are crucial in maintaining operational security and ensuring the integrity of sensitive communications.

One prevalent method involves the use of secure communication devices, such as encryption tools, which protect messages from interception. Additionally, operatives may use coded language or prearranged signals to convey information discreetly, minimizing the risk of exposure during exchanges.

In-person meetings are another effective technique, allowing for direct communication without the risks associated with electronic surveillance. These meetings are often conducted in controlled environments to further mitigate the possibility of being overheard or observed.

Furthermore, the use of dead drops and other clandestine methods enhances communication in operational settings. These techniques are fundamental in ensuring that vital information remains confidential and only accessible to authorized personnel within intelligence operations.

Open-Source Intelligence (OSINT)

Open-source intelligence (OSINT) refers to the collection and analysis of publicly available information to support intelligence operations. This data can be found across various platforms, including the internet, social media, public records, and traditional media. OSINT is vital for gathering insights and situational awareness in military intelligence.

The techniques employed in OSINT are diverse and can be categorized into several key areas:

  • Web-based research: Leveraging search engines and databases for detailed analysis.
  • Social media monitoring: Analyzing platforms like Twitter and Facebook for trends and public sentiment.
  • Geospatial analysis: Utilizing satellite imagery and mapping services to assess physical environments.
  • Database utilization: Accessing government and organizational databases for statistics and reports.

Human Intelligence (HUMINT) Methods

Human Intelligence (HUMINT) methods involve the collection of information through interpersonal interactions and human sources. This technique relies heavily on establishing trust and gathering insights directly from individuals, thereby creating deep, contextualized understanding essential for intelligence operations.

Recruitment of informants is a pivotal HUMINT method. Agents often cultivate relationships with individuals who have access to valuable information, such as local populations, government officials, or business leaders. These informants provide firsthand accounts of events and activities that are crucial for operational success.

Another significant methodology involves debriefing. After missions, operatives engage sources to extract usable intelligence about enemy movements or strategic capabilities. This interaction helps to fill intelligence gaps, providing a clearer situational picture for decision-makers.

Finally, observation and social engineering play vital roles in HUMINT operations. Observing behaviors, interactions, and environments leads to insights. Social engineering, on the other hand, manipulates environments and interactions to elicit information, ensuring a comprehensive tradecraft approach to gathering intelligence.

Counterintelligence Tradecraft Techniques

Counterintelligence tradecraft techniques focus on identifying and mitigating threats from adversaries attempting to gather intelligence or disrupt operations. These techniques are critical for safeguarding sensitive information and maintaining operational integrity.

One common technique involves deception, where misleading information is deliberately disseminated. This approach can divert adversaries’ attention or lead them to false conclusions, thereby protecting valuable intelligence assets. Counter-surveillance operations complement this strategy by detecting and neutralizing potential surveillance efforts from opposing entities.

Operational security (OPSEC) is another cornerstone of counterintelligence tradecraft. By assessing vulnerabilities and implementing protective measures, organizations can reduce the risk of sensitive data exposure. Training personnel to recognize signs of potential espionage is equally vital, as awareness plays a significant role in thwarting threats.

Analytical techniques enhance counterintelligence efforts by identifying patterns and anomalies in behavior. This proactive approach allows intelligence operatives to anticipate and counteract adversary actions, ensuring a robust defense against espionage and intelligence gathering.

Cyber Espionage Techniques

Cyber espionage techniques encompass a range of methods employed to infiltrate and gather sensitive information from computer systems and networks. These techniques utilize both advanced technology and psychological tactics to exploit vulnerabilities. Understanding these methods is vital for defense against potential breaches.

One common technique is spear phishing, where attackers send targeted emails containing malicious links or attachments, tricking individuals into revealing confidential information. Additionally, advanced persistent threats (APTs) represent coordinated attacks that exploit weaknesses over time, enabling sustained access to critical systems.

Another prevalent method is the use of malware, such as keyloggers or remote access trojans, to capture keystrokes or take control of infected systems. These tools are often delivered through compromised websites or corrupted software, making detection challenging.

Lastly, social engineering plays a significant role in cyber espionage. This technique involves manipulating individuals into divulging information or granting access by exploiting human psychology. Defensive Cyber Tradecraft

Defensive cyber tradecraft encompasses a range of strategies and protocols employed to safeguard information and systems from unauthorized access, exploitation, or disruption. This component of tradecraft is integral to maintaining the integrity of intelligence operations in an increasingly digital landscape.

Key tactics include regular security assessments, which identify vulnerabilities within systems. Organizations often implement firewalls, intrusion detection systems, and encryption techniques to create layered defenses that protect sensitive data from cyber threats.

Employee training is another critical aspect of defensive cyber tradecraft. Security awareness programs educate personnel on recognizing phishing attempts and other tactics used by cyber adversaries. This proactive approach helps minimize the risk of human error, which is often a significant factor in successful cyber-attacks.

Finally, incident response planning is essential for mitigating the impact of breaches. Organizations must establish procedures to swiftly address cyber incidents, including isolation of affected systems, forensic analysis, and communication with relevant authorities. Continuous improvement of these defensive cyber tradecraft techniques ensures organizations remain resilient against evolving cyber threats.
